概括
一名91岁的老人在接种了第二剂瑞-生物科技COVID-19疫苗后出现了皮肤水泡状的情况. 这种罕见的不良事件凸显了疫苗接种后皮肤学副作用监测的重要性.

主要成果:
- 患者在接种了第二剂Pfizer-BioNTech疫苗后48小时出现了紧张的水泡和肢体侵蚀.
- 粘膜没有受到影响,尼科尔斯基的信号是负的.
- 患者没有报告其他疫苗接种后不良反应.
结论:
- 时间关联表明瑞生物科技COVID-19疫苗与这种水泡性皮肤病的发展之间可能存在联系.
- 需要进一步的调查和监测,以确定这种罕见的疫苗相关皮肤反应的发生率和机制.
